Endoscopy is an important tool for diagnosing and treating a variety of medical conditions. It is a minimally invasive procedure that uses a flexible tube with a camera and light at the end to examine the inside of the body. Endoscopy has revolutionized the way doctors diagnose and treat a wide range of conditions, from gastrointestinal issues to cancer. As technology continues to advance, endoscopy is becoming more and more sophisticated, allowing doctors to make more accurate diagnoses and provide more effective treatments. In this article, we will discuss how technology is revolutionizing endoscopy and how it is improving diagnosis and treatment.
Endoscopy is a valuable tool for diagnosing and treating a variety of medical conditions. It is minimally invasive, meaning it does not require major surgery or long recovery times. It also allows doctors to see inside the body and make a diagnosis without having to rely on imaging tests or exploratory surgery. Endoscopy can be used to detect and treat a wide range of conditions, from gastrointestinal issues to cancer.
